  The best image for illustrating bicycle touring in South Korea is two-wheeled kaleidoscope.  With every turn of the wheels there is a fascinating shift of perspective, color, texture and composition.  The towns are colorful, the villages are quaint, the farmland has colors, hues and texture, the mountains are layered, and the streams are past, present and future all at once.  The pictures below are only snap shots and don't do it justice to the country.  For every city picture there are a million more. For every farm valley picture there are a million more. For every temple picture there are a million more. For every face picture there are a million more.  To understand the enrichment of bicycle travel in South Korea you need to not only see everything the is shown here, but everything that is not shown as well.  It is well worth a personal visit.
